  Modular and hierarchical modelling concept for large biological Petri nets applied to nociception

Blätke, M. A., & Marwan, W. (2010). Modular and hierarchical modelling concept for large biological Petri nets applied to nociception. In M. Schwarick, & M. Heiner (Eds.), Proceedings of the 17th German Workshop on Algorithms and Tools for Petri Nets (pp. 42-50).
